WILLIAM EDGAR

California/Australia, 1870-c. 1925

The schooner Herman.

Signed lower right "W. Edgar".
Oil on canvas, 16" x 24". Framed 19.75" x 27.75".
Condition: Overall very good condition. The canvas is unlined and under UV examination there are no apparent signs of restoration or repair. Under white light there is a stable craquelure across the surface of the canvas, however the painting presents well and can be hung as is.

  • Provenance:
    A private collection, Southern California.
    The West Sea Company, Old Town, San Diego, California.
    The Kelton Collection of Marine Art & Artifacts.

    Matthew Turner (1825-1909), who built the
    Herman , was an American sea captain, shipbuilder and designer. He constructed 228 vessels, of which 154 were built in the Matthew Turner shipyard in Benicia. He built more sailing vessels than any other single shipbuilder in America and can be considered the "granddaddy" of big-time wooden shipbuilding on the Pacific Coast.
